What happens during reflux in ethyl Ethanoate?
When ethyl ethanoate is heated under reflux with a dilute acid such as dilute hydrochloric acid or dilute sulfuric acid, the ester reacts with the water present to produce ethanoic acid and ethanol.
What is ester reflux?
Refluxing: The process of heating a reaction mixture in a vessel with a condenser tube attached. Esterification reactions are refluxed to prevent: The build-up of pressure that occurs with a closed vessel reaction. The loss of volatile components.
Why do esters float on water?
The ester is not very soluble in water so will separate into a separate layer. The ester is less dense than water so the ester layer floats on top of the aqueous layer.
Why is reflux used in ester hydrolysis?
Hydrolysis using dilute alkali The ester is heated under reflux with a dilute alkali like sodium hydroxide solution. There are two big advantages of doing this rather than using a dilute acid. The reactions are one-way rather than reversible, and the products are easier to separate.

How do you test for esters?
Ferric Hydroxamate Test for Esters. If you have a carbonyl compound which is not an aldehyde or ketone or carboxylic acid, it could be an ester. One test for esters is the ferric hydroxamate test whereby the ester is converted to a hydroxamic acid (HOHN-C=O) which will give a positive ferric chloride test.

What happens when an ester is hydrolysed?
Hydrolysis is a most important reaction of esters. Acidic hydrolysis of an ester gives a carboxylic acid and an alcohol. Basic hydrolysis of an ester gives a carboxylate salt and an alcohol.
How does reflux improve distillation?
Reflux in industrial distillation Inside the column, the downflowing reflux liquid provides cooling and condensation of the upflowing vapors thereby increasing the efficiency of the distillation column.

Why is reflux performed?
In order to ensure no loss of reactants or solvent, a reflux system is used in order to condense any vapors produced on heating and return these condensates to the reaction vessel.
What is reflux in Fischer esterification?
The Fischer esterification is conducted at reflux. The purpose of reflux is to heat a reaction mixture at its boiling temperature to form products, without losing any of the compounds in the reaction flask. In practice, a condenser is set vertically into the top of the reaction flask.
